From ae88738a968f6b92d77885682079c57099d65308 Mon Sep 17 00:00:00 2001 From: NullBite <me@nullbite.com> Date: Sat, 10 Feb 2024 23:15:31 +0100 Subject: [PATCH] Update android configuration --- system/fragments/android.nix | 13 ++++++++++--- 1 file changed, 10 insertions(+), 3 deletions(-) diff --git a/system/fragments/android.nix b/system/fragments/android.nix index 39a069c..d5464de 100644 --- a/system/fragments/android.nix +++ b/system/fragments/android.nix @@ -1,8 +1,15 @@ { config, lib, pkgs, outputs, vars, ...}@args: +let + cfg = config.nixfiles.programs.adb; +in { - imports = [ outputs.nixosModules.adb ]; - - config = { + # imports = [ outputs.nixosModules.adb ]; + + options.nixfiles.programs.adb = { + enable = lib.mkEnableOption "adb configuration"; + }; + + config = lib.mkIf cfg.enable { programs.adb.enable = true; users.users.${vars.username}.extraGroups = [ "adbusers" ]; };